On 10 Aug 2014 at 2:40pm Sussex Jim wrote:
If the Government reduces the rate of VAT, it will have to raise other taxes to compensate. At least with VAT everybody makes some contribution to the running of the country and the provision of services- unless you live on basic food and only drink water; and spend nothing on "luxuries".

On 10 Aug 2014 at 9:26pm edtheplumber wrote:
Actually, Sussex Jim; it isn't that simple. A cut in VAT may INCREASE tax revenues by increasing spending. It may not, but one cannot say a cut in one tax will need to be offset by increases elsewhere.
Alternatively, one cannot say putting the top income tax up to 60% would bring in £X more revenue. As the top earners would find methods of avoiding tax, and revenue may even decrease - as happened with the 50% income tax.
